Saturday, March 19, 2011

Sequencing EclipseIDE 3.1

Type of Sequencing : MNT
Sequencer : 4.6(x64)
OS : Win7

Issue :  The application throws the below following error when eclipse.exe shortcut is launched





Solution :
Uncheck the override option to all the folders
Mark all the folders to Merge with local directory

Note : Merging the directory seems to be wierd technically speaking but this worked like a charm

Sequencing Cygwin1.7.5

Type of Sequencing : MNT
Sequencer : 4.6(x64)
OS : Win7
Issue :

1) The application throws the below following error when launched :
46027C5-16D1190A-0000E01E

2) XWinServer shortcut fails to launch with the error as shown below :
A fatal error has occurred and Cygwin/X will now
exit. Please open /tmp/XWin.log for more information. 
Vendor:  The Cygwin/X Project
Release: 6.8.99.901-4
Contact: cygwin-xfree@cygwin.com
XWin was startedwith the following command-line:
XWin -clipboard -silent-dup-error 

Solution :

1) In the Package Configuration Wizard mark the home dir under Q:\8.3\cygwin\home as userdata and uncheck override option

2) This error occurs as the startxwin.exe process fails to start from the virtual bubble
Add a environment variable to add PATH=Q:\8.3\Cygwin\bin
uncheck security descriptors
Edit the OSD to add a prelaunch script to start startxwin.exe as below
Q:\8.3\Cygwin\bin\startxwin.exe -- -nolock

Note : If the pre-launch script pops up everytime then add this script in a wrapper exe created from wise so that the user will not get the cmd window when the shortcut is launched everytime

Sequencing Share Point Designer 2007

Type of Sequencing : VFS
Sequencer : 4.6(x64)
OS : WinXP

Issue : The application goes for a heal everytime the shortcut is launched or it throws an error saying the application needs to be reinstalled

Solution : Try the method as given in the blog below
http://appvgeek.blogspot.com/2010/11/sequencing-sharepoint-designer-2007.html
This will not work if the application is sequenced on Win7 as it throws the same error. So the best way of doing it is to sequence the app on XP and deploy on Win7 environment

Tuesday, February 22, 2011

Sequencing Paint.NET 3.X

Type of Sequencing : MNT
Sequencer : 4.6(x64)
OS : Win7


Issue : There are three errors you may get while sequencing paint.net

Error 1 : The below screen shot error is thrown when the shortcut is launched during monitoring phase.



Error 2 : After stop monitoring it fails to capture the WinSxS components.

Error 3 : The below error is thrown in launch phase and the same when tested on client machine as well.





We tried to sequence on WinXP with all the redistributables and deployed on Win7 but with no success.

Solution : The below methods helped us to make the Paint.Net application to be sequenced successfully:

1) Edited the MSI to remove x86 manifest components
2) Prior to monitoring exclude CSIDL_Desktop, Windows\Installer and disable system restore.
3) Install the modified msi with  CHECKFORUPDATES=0 as a parameter
4) Dont launch the shortcut during monitoring phase
5) Stop monitor
6) Begin monitor
7) Launch the shortcut


Sunday, February 20, 2011

Sequencing BRR Fix 3.0

Type of Sequencing : MNT
Sequencer : 4.6(x64)
OS : Win7

Issue : The application should launch the exe located in the mapped Z: drive and we need to create another shortcut to launch the BRR folder from the Z Drive

Solution : Sequence the application and edit the FILENAME="Z:\BRR\BRR_Update.exe" in OSD
and for the second issue perform the following things as given below:
1) Make a copy of the already existing OSD
2) Edit the Copied OSD with new Package Name and version
3) Edit the entries inside the SPRJ with new OSD name
4) Edit the OSD to point to the folder location as below
FILENAME = "%systemroot%\explorer.exe" PARAMETERS="Z:\BRR\"

Sequencing Oracle ODBC Administartor 12.0

Type of Sequencing : MNT
Sequencer : 4.6(x86)
OS : Win7

Error : When the ODBC Admin shortcut is launched it throws the below following error





Solution : To solve the above problem, Add the below to the OSD File
<ENVLIST>
<ENVIRONMENT VARIABLE="__COMPAT_LAYER">RunAsInvoker</ENVIRONMENT>
</ENVLIST>

Friday, February 18, 2011

Sequencing IManager Worksite 8.5

Type of Sequencing : MNT
Sequencer : 4.6(x64)
OS : Win7

Issue : The application when launched opens a server prompt and when the user  logs in creates a folder under C:\NTECHO and saves some files. The user wanted the folder to be created on the local machine but the application was creating a folder inside the virtual bubble

Solution : 1) Open the package for upgrade and delete the C:\NTECHO folder from the Virtual Files tab.
2) Edit the OSD to create the NTECHO folder in C drive as shown below:
<SCRIPT EVENT="LAUNCH" TIMING="PRE" PROTECT="TRUE" WAIT="TRUE">
<SCRIPTBODY>MD "C:\NTECHO"</SCRIPTBODY>
</SCRIPT>

Sequencing Nice Screen Agent 8.1.0

Type of Sequencing : MNT
Sequencer : 4.6(x64)
OS : Win7

Issue : The application fails to view some local registries from the virtual bubble

Solution : Since the application already has the HKLM\Software\NSAC inside the virtual bubble it was overriding the local registies. The virtual application should see the Region key  value under HKLM\Software\NSAC from the local registries. Open the package for upgrade Go To-> Package Configuration Wizard->Virtual Registry->  and change the particular key HKLM\Software\NSAC to Merge with local key.

Sequencing NBalance 6.0

Type of Sequencing : MNT
Sequencer : 4.6(x64)
OS : Win7

Error : The application shortcut throws a "Working Directory Name Invalid" error

Solution : Edit the OSD file to remove " ~" under filename %SFT_Program_Files~%

Sequencing Prosoft SOA Test 6.2

Type of Sequencing : MNT
Sequencer : 4.6(x64)
OS : Win7

Issue : When the application is launched by default it takes the sequencer admin profile path in the prompt window.

Solution : Don't launch the shortcut during monitoring phase and launch phase

Wednesday, February 16, 2011

Sequencing Jasc PaintShopPro 8.0

Type of Sequencing : MNT
Sequencer : 4.6(x86)
OS : Win7

Error : There are two issues when the application is launched
1) The first error is the working directory invalid error:


2) The second error is as shown below:



Solution :
1) Set the working directory properly
2) Remove %USERPROFILE%\My documents from exclusion items or add these files as in active upgrade
3) Check for the correct path after launching the shortcut under File->Preferences->File Locations   

Saturday, February 12, 2011

Sequencing Clarity Workbench 7.0

Type of Sequencing : MNT
Sequencer : 4.6(x86)
OS : Win7
Error: The application throws the below following error when launched:


Solution : During capturing phase give the path of the location of library files inside Q: drive
Launch the shortcut ->Go to Tools -> Options - >Locations
Below following window will be displayed:



Edit all the path of the locations to point to Q drive

Sequencing BPC SqueezeItPlus 1.2

Type of Sequencing : MNT
Sequencer : 4.6(x86)
OS : Win7
Error : When application is launched it throws the below following error:



Solution : The main EXE internally calls another exe GSW32.exe. So we can solve this issue in two ways:

1) During Configuration phase add GSW32.exe as a shortcut and edit the OSD as shown below:

 <SCRIPT EVENT="LAUNCH" PROTECT="TRUE" TIMING="PRE" WAIT="TRUE" EXTERN="TRUE">
   <SCRIPTBODY LANGUAGE="Batch">sfttray /launch "Graphics Server"</SCRIPTBODY>
  </SCRIPT>
<SCRIPT EVENT="SHUTDOWN" PROTECT="TRUE" TIMING="POST" WAIT="TRUE" EXTERN="TRUE">
   <SCRIPTBODY LANGUAGE="Batch">taskkill /IM Gsw32.exe</SCRIPTBODY>
  </SCRIPT>

2) Add a pre-Launch script inside the OSD to run GSW32.exe

<SCRIPT EVENT="LAUNCH" PROTECT="TRUE" TIMING="PRE" WAIT="TRUE" EXTERN="TRUE">
   <SCRIPTBODY LANGUAGE="Batch">path of Gsw32.exe</SCRIPTBODY>
  </SCRIPT>

Sequencing StreetSmartPro 2011

Type of Sequencing : MNT
Sequencer : 4.6(x64)
OS : Win7

Error : When application is launched it throws an error which says " that you have encountered a serious error" .

Solution : The application has compatibility issues it has to be run on WinXPSP3 mode add the below following key inside the bubble while capturing or add the key through OSD scripting.
HKEY_CURRENT_USER\Software\Microsoft\Windows NT\CurrentVersion\AppCompatFlags\Layers
put
Data Type reg_SZ
Name:  Path of the exe for which compatibilty issue is there .i.e (Q:\8.3Folder structure\vfs\csidl_Program_files\name of EXE)
Value : WINXPSP3

Friday, February 11, 2011

Sequencing Attachmate Reflection 14.X

Type of Sequencing : MNT
Sequencer : 4.6(x64)
OS : Win7

Error : When tried sequencing VFS the application launch throws an error which says " The application failed to initiate please reinstall the application"

Solution :
1) Remove all items from Exclusion items
2) Do MNT sequencing

Sequencing VMWare View Client 4.5

Type of Sequencing : MNT
Sequencer : 4.6(x64)
OS : Win7

Error : When application is launched you get a error which says " VMWare View Client could not find the plugin path. Please re-install the application"

Solution : The sequencer fails to capture the registries going under HLM\Software\Syswow64\Vmware resulting in failure of the application launch. Export the registry entries and run it inside the OSD Script as shown below:

<SCRIPT EVENT="LAUNCH" PROTECT="TRUE" TIMING="PRE" WAIT="TRUE">
<SCRIPTBODY>Regedit.exe /s "%SFT_MNT%\8.3\*.reg</SCRIPTBODY>
  </SCRIPT>

Note: Manually adding the registries from the virtual registry tab in package configuration wizard did not work as the registries were not reflected in the client machine.

Sequencing Logtech LAS Tools Pro 6.0

Type of Sequencing : MNT
Sequencer : 4.6(x86)
OS : Win7

Error : The application makes an entry Under Users\yourusername \AppData\Roaming\Microsoft\Windows\SendTo but this will not work when the entry is in the bubble.

Solution : Edit the OSD to copy the lnk file to the local machine as shown below :

<SCRIPT EVENT="LAUNCH" PROTECT="TRUE" TIMING="PRE" WAIT="TRUE">
<SCRIPTBODY>if not exist "%USERPROFILE%\AppData\Roaming\Microsoft\Windows\SendTo\Las.lnk" copy "Q:\8.3\LAS.lnk" "%USERPROFILE%\AppData\Roaming\Microsoft\Windows\SendTo\"</SCRIPTBODY>
  </SCRIPT>

Note : The only issue with this solution is that the SendTo functionality will work only when the application is launched.

Thursday, January 27, 2011

Sequencing Apple QuickTime 7.5

Type of Sequencing : MNT
Sequencer : 4.6(x86)
OS : Win7

Error : The application fails to look for the QuickTime.qtp config file inside the virtual  bubble.

Solution : Edit the OSD to copy the qtp file to the local machine as shown below :

<SCRIPT EVENT="LAUNCH" PROTECT="TRUE" TIMING="PRE" WAIT="TRUE">
<SCRIPTBODY>MD "%USERPROFILE%\AppData\LocalLow\Apple Computer\QuickTime\"</SCRIPTBODY>
  </SCRIPT>
<SCRIPT EVENT="LAUNCH" PROTECT="TRUE" TIMING="PRE" WAIT="TRUE">
<SCRIPTBODY>if not exist "%USERPROFILE%\AppData\LocalLow\Apple Computer\QuickTime\QuickTime.qtp" copy "Q:\8.3\QuickTime.qtp" "%USERPROFILE%\AppData\LocalLow\Apple Computer\QuickTime\"</SCRIPTBODY>
  </SCRIPT>

Sequencing IBM Lotus Notes 4.6

Type of Sequencing : MNT
Sequencer : 4.6(x86)
OS : Win7

Error : After launching the shortcut the task bar menu shows as " IBM Lotus Notes 4.6 launching" but the application automatically shutsdown without any application launch window.

Solution : This is because of the incorrect path in Notes.ini file under C:\windows.
Open the sequenced version for upgrade and edit the Notes.ini file under Q:\8.3\VFS\CSIDL_Windows
As we hav done an MNT we have to edit the Notes.ini file as mentioned below.

Original
Directory=c:\notes\data
WinNTIconPath=c:\notes\data\W32
FileDlgDirectory=c:\notes\data

Modified

Directory=Q:\8.3 Name\notes\data
WinNTIconPath=Q:\8.3 Name\notes\data\W32
FileDlgDirectory=Q:\8.3 Name\notes\data

Monday, January 24, 2011

Sequencing Adobe Photoshop 7.0

Type of Sequencing : MNT
Sequencer : 4.6(x86)
OS : Win7

Error : When Adobe Gamma loader shortcut is launched the user will get a popup error as shown in the below screenshot

Solution : Edit the working directory tag and  keep it empty <WORKINGDIR/>
Note : The Adobe Gamma Loader shortcut when launched just runs a process in the background and automatically shutsdown.
The same is applicable for Microsoft Powerpoint Viewer 2007 as it throws the same error as mentioned above

Sunday, January 23, 2011

Sequencing Statgen Readycash v1.0

Type of Sequencing : MNT
Sequencer : 4.5
OS: WinXP

Error:





Solution : Uncheck Security Descriptors checkbox before saving the sequenced application